A number of years back, Dwayne Beck proposed that with no-till and good crop diversity, we should be moving toward thinking about soil fertility as a biologically mediated process, rather than a simple chemical extraction of X correlating to crop response.  It is a good way to think about it, and has some merit even in tillage systems.  What the microbes are doing can easily 'swamp' whatever management is trying to do.
